In the year 2045, reality is an ugly place. The only time Wade Watts really feels alive is when he’s jacked into the OASIS, a vast virtual world where most of humanity spends their days. When the eccentric creator of the OASIS dies, he leaves behind a series of fiendish puzzles, based on his obsession with the pop culture of decades past. Whoever is first to solve them will inherit his vast fortune—and control of the OASIS itself.

Never Work Again shows you how you can build a successful and profitable business without the long hours and high stress that most entrepreneurs suffer from. Trust me - I've been there and it's not fun. In the months after I started my first business I didn't know any better. My business was making me ill, but I was too wrapped up in what I was doing to spot the signs let alone to do anything about it.

Do not judge the book by its cover
Revisado: 03-31-15
You will have better use out of the four hour workweek by Tim Ferris and rich dad poor dad. Very obvious that these books were referenced heavily when he wrote this book or should I say just copied the ideas. Also he mentions his website about 100 times, no doubt, using this book to funnel you there in order to buy a more expensive piece of information that probably delivers the same copied ideas...
